Immediate Post-laparotomy Hypotension in Patients with Severe Traumatic Hemoperitoneum

Abstract

Purpose: Immediate post-laparotomy hypotension (PLH) is a precipitous drop in blood pressure caused by a sudden release of abdominal tamponade after laparotomy in cases of severe hemoperitoneum.The effect of laparotomy on blood pressure in patients with significant hemoperitoneum is unknown.methods: In total, 163 patients underwent laparotomy for trauma from January 1, 2013 to December 31, 2015.Exclusion criteria included the following: negative laparotomy, only a hollow viscous injury, and hemoperitoneum <1,000 mL.After applying those criteria, 62 patients were enrolled in this retrospective review.PLH was defined as a decrease in the mean arterial pressure (MAP) ≥10 mmHg within 10 minutes after laparotomy.results: The mean estimated hemoperitoneum was 3,516 mL.The incidence of PLH was 23% (14 of 62 patients).The MAP did not show significant differences before and after laparotomy (5 minutes post-laparotomy, 67.5±16.5 vs. 68.3±18.8mmHg; p=0.7; 10 minutes post-laparotomy, 67.5±16.5 vs. 70.4±18.8mmHg; p=0.193).The overall in-hospital mortality was 24% (15 of 62 patients).Mortality was not significantly higher in the PLH group (two of 14 [14.3%] vs. 13 of 48 [27.1%]; p=0.33).No statistically significant between-group differences were observed in the intensive care unit and hospital stay.Conclusions: PLH may be less frequent and less devastating than it is often considered.Surgical hemostasis during laparotomy is important.Laparotomy with adequate resuscitation may explain the equivalent outcomes in the two groups.
